Clive Hart is an esteemed scholar primarily recognized for his contributions to the study of James Joyce's works. His notable publications include "A Concordance to Finnegans Wake," which serves as a valuable reference for scholars and enthusiasts alike, helping to navigate the complexities of Joyce's most challenging text. Hart's academic pursuits extend beyond Joyce, as he has engaged with various literary subjects, showcasing his breadth of knowledge and passion for literature.
In addition to his scholarly writings, Hart's works like "An Admonition to the Students of Wittenberg" and "James Joyce's Dublin: A Topographical Guide to the Dublin of Ulysses" further illustrate his dedication to understanding and contextualizing literary texts within their geographical and historical frameworks. His insights not only deepen the appreciation of Joyce's literature but also invite readers to explore the intricacies of Dublin as depicted in Joyce's narratives. Hart's influence on literary criticism is significant, making him a prominent figure in contemporary literary studies.
